Patrick O'Shei is a seasoned, well-rounded executive whose

strengths lie in both executive-level strategy and hands-on frontline support as a mentor/coach and analyst. He enjoys solving complex problems, implementing real-world and practical solutions and achieving results while helping to develop the capabilities of the people around him. He has created a unique body of work by applying his statistical and process improvement knowledge (Constraint Management, etc.) to the financial analysis of existing businesses and their asset utilization to create financial viability. He has done focused empirical market and competitive analysis.
He has trained and developed leaders and teams in a variety of settings from large manufacturers to construction, hospitality and adult education. He has specific knowledge and experience in manufacturing and converting operations including process control, quality assurance, cycle-time reduction, just-in-time methods, safety management (DuPont System), product development (Quality Function Deployment) and continuous improvement methods (Six-Sigma, Constraint Management, Statistical Process Control & Design of Experiments). He has worked extensively with both suppliers and customers including site-visits, field trials and negotiations. He uses a sophisticated set of analytical skills for evaluating the root cause of negative effects and determining the points of leverage for optimizing process performance and product design.
As an executive overseeing capital investment, he has excellent working knowledge of environmental permitting, OSHA compliance and experience working with governmental & regulatory agencies. Some of his specific accomplishments include:
- Completing the business planning & financial analysis for $20 MM in borrowing and coordinating all necessary permitting, site remediation and bidding/contract negotiations required to begin construction.
- Overseeing construction of a new waste-water treatment facility, a 300 bay parking lot and a six-story housing and conference facility which incorporates leading edge environmental design including radiant heating & cooling as well as day-lighting and passive cooling design elements.
- Brought a 50-year old (150,000 sq. ft.) multi-use structure into ADA compliance.
His recent professional history includes work at ESCO Energy Services (VP Operations & Finance), the Kripalu Center (VP Business, Facility & Technology Development), SUNY Empire State College (Mentor/Lecturer) and Applied Energy Management, as well as independent project-based consulting work.
Patrick’s twenty eight years of professional experience and much of his consulting work have been with firms selling into the highly demanding Automotive, Food, Medical Markets, Aerospace and Electronics Markets.
Patrick spent 10 years working for Fortune 500 manufacturing firms. He worked for both International Paper (as a Process Engineer, and a Superintendent for Quality, serving as the quality/ technical liaison with Xerox Corporation), and for The Dexter Corporation, where he was the Director for Total Quality Systems and oversaw the supplier quality program.
Patrick holds an MS from Rochester Institute of Technology in Applied Statistics and BS Engineering from SUNY College of Environmental Science & Forestry. He was a certified quality engineer (ASQ) for six years and trained as a lead auditor for ISO 9000 Quality Systems. During the development and rollout of the Malcolm Baldridge National Quality Award, he was charged with benchmarking the winners, and incorporating their processes at Dexter. He has participated in the educational offerings of Motorola (Six Sigma), Xerox (Leadership through Quality, Benchmarking), Milliken (Quick Response & Visual/Metric Management) and others.
